The Lagos State AIDS Control Agency (LSACA) has launched its State wide Free HIV Testing Services, set to run across all Local Government Areas (LGAs) and Local Council Development Areas (LCDAs).
The activity, scheduled for 18th November to 1st December 2025 is part of the government plans towards marking the 2025 World AIDS Day.
This activity shows the renewed commitment of LSACA in expanding access for HIV testing, strengthening early diagnosis, and ensuring seamless linkage to care for residents across the state. According to the Agency, the exercise is designed to close existing testing gaps and deepen community-level awareness on HIV prevention, management, and stigma reduction.
The Chief Executive Officer of LSACA, Dr Folakemi Animashaun, highlighted the central role of early testing in achieving the state’s public health goals. “As we approach the 2025 World AIDS Day, our priority is to ensure that every Lagos resident has the opportunity to know their HIV status in a safe, confidential, and accessible manner. Testing remains the gateway to both prevention and treatment, and this state-wide initiative reflects our continuous commitment to protecting the health and well-being of all Lagosians,” she said.
Dr Animashaun noted that LSACA is working closely with development partners and community-based organisations has deployed trained counsellor-testers, adequate HIV test kits, condoms, and IEC materials to facilitate smooth operations across all designated points.
She further urged residents to take full advantage of the free service, stressing that the testing centres within the LGAs and LCDAs have been structured to offer confidential, non-judgmental, and user-friendly services.
Reaffirming the Lagos State Government’s commitment to improved healthcare access, the CEO also referenced ongoing investments in expanding HIV testing and counselling centres, enhancing community outreach, and intensifying awareness campaigns geared towards reducing new infections.
